############################################################################ # This script will export snapshots for two properties in every loaded case # And put them in a snapshots folder in the same folder as the case grid ############################################################################ import os import rips # Load instance resinsight = rips.Instance.find() cases = resinsight.project.cases() # Set main window size resinsight.set_main_window_size(width=800, height=500) n = 5 # every n-th time_step for snapshot property_list = ["SOIL", "PRESSURE"] # list of parameter for snapshot print("Looping through cases") for case in cases: print("Case name: ", case.name) print("Case id: ", case.id) # Get grid path and its folder name case_path = case.file_path folder_name = os.path.dirname(case_path) # create a folder to hold the snapshots dirname = os.path.join(folder_name, "snapshots") if os.path.exists(dirname) is False: os.mkdir(dirname) print("Exporting to folder: " + dirname) resinsight.set_export_folder(export_type="SNAPSHOTS", path=dirname) time_steps = case.time_steps() print("Number of time_steps: " + str(len(time_steps))) for view in case.views(): if view.is_eclipse_view(): for property in property_list: view.apply_cell_result( result_type="DYNAMIC_NATIVE", result_variable=property ) for time_step in range(0, len(time_steps), 10): view.set_time_step(time_step=time_step) view.export_snapshot()
